Subject: Collection of Nearby Vacation Spots Near Shuls

Buffalo, N.Y. - - Marriot is across the street from the Young Israel of Amherst, supermarket with kosher products nearby. Nearby attractions include Howe Caverns, Corning, Glen Watkins, Niagara Falls. (recommended by Bernice Gilbert)

Brookline, Mass - Holiday Inn near shul and kosher shopping. Courtyard Marriott near the Young Israel of Brookline. Nearby attractions include Harvard, Boston Children’s Museum, Boston Habor, Museums. (recommended by Bernice Gilbert) Check the Young Israel of Brookline website for more information.

Bradley Beach, NJ - a shul in walking distance to several bed and breakfasts, it’s 1.5 hours away from Teaneck, you can pick up food from the Kosher Experience or Shoprite in Neptune 10 minutes away. Cong. Agudath Achim has information about the hotels 732-774--2495

Point Pleasant, NJ - on the Jersey shore, a lovely beach and amusement park on the boardwalk, 20 minutes away from Deal where there are many kosher restaurants. (recommended by Elissa Richter)

New Brunswick, NJ - Hyatt Hotel, a shul down the block and a five minute drive from Highland Park, which has kosher eateries. There are also Sabbath observant rooms where they will give you a real key.

Long Branch, NJ - on the Jersey Shore, The Ocean Place Resort, a two mile walk to shuls and occasionally has its own minyan, near kosher eateries in Deal and supermarkets. Nearby attractions include Point Pleasant boardwalk and amusement park, aquarium, Seven President’s Park, (recommended by D. Yellin)

Harmony Ridge - an hour away from Teaneck - (recommended by Onit Brodsky)

Lancaster, PA - The Lancaster Hotel, across the street from Dutch Wonderland, which has a kosher concessian stand. The Orthodox Lancaster shul is nearby. (recommended by Julie Farkas)

Newport, RI - beautiful mansion tours, beach, antiques, charming town, the Touro Synagogue which is the oldest shul in the country has regular minyanim. There are numerous hotels in the area.

Cape Cod - Chabad of Hyannis runs a shabbat minyan. Stop & Shop has kosher food and kosher bakery. Kosher deli in Hyanis run by Chabad. (recommended by Ellen Finkelstein)

Myrtle Beach, SC - chabad shul is walking distance from Sheraton Vistana and other Broadway at the Beach hotels. Glatt kosher Jerusalem Restaurant is a block from the beach.

Westhampton Beach - has an Orthodox synagogue with dynamic shabbat programs, there are several kosher restaurants in the area. (recommended by D. Yellin)

Orlando, Fl - Kosher Resorts Orlando has package deals for shabbos and yom tov including kosher meals and minyanim - 800-747-0013 (recommended by D. Yellin)

Palm Beach, Fl - The Breakers Resort, a world class hotel resort on the beach in walking distance to a shul and in driving distance to a kosher supermarket and some kosher eateries (recommended by D. Yellin)

Subject: Family resort recommendations
Now that summer is over we would like to compile a list of family resorts that people were happy with. We prefer resorts that have full kitchens and separate living and sleeping areas. We also prefer shorter distances.

We can recommend both Smuggler's Notch in Vermont and Split Rock Resort in the Poconos. Smuggler's has an additional advantage of having day camp for children so the adults can participate in resort activities that are not meant for small children. Split Rock had an option for day camp which was only 2 1/2 at a time either morning or afternoon (or both, each session for a small fee).

We have also been to Golden Acres which is more of a ranch like setting. Their main advantage is having a kosher dining room. They too have a day camp. The accomodations would be rated with fewer "stars" so to speak. The recently changed ownership so we don't know if anything else changed.
